Understanding Digital Asset Storage: A Complete Guide to Choosing Your Crypto Wallet
The Fundamentals: What Your Crypto Wallet Really Does
Think of a crypto wallet as your personal digital vault. Just as you’d keep cash in a physical wallet, you use a crypto wallet to hold and manage your digital currencies and NFTs. But here’s the key difference: cryptocurrencies exist only as digital records on the blockchain, so your wallet actually stores something far more important—the cryptographic keys that prove you own those assets.
Ownership in the crypto world works differently than traditional finance. You can’t physically hold Bitcoin or Ethereum like you would dollar bills. Instead, you need unique identification codes—your keys—to demonstrate that those digital assets belong to you. This is where crypto wallets become essential: they securely store these keys and enable you to transact on blockchain networks.
The Two Keys That Control Your Wealth
Every crypto wallet operates using a pair of cryptographic codes working in tandem. Understanding this is crucial to using wallets safely.
Your Public Key—Your Wallet Address This is essentially your account number. Anyone can view it, and it’s the address you share when you want others to send you cryptocurrency. Think of it like your email address—public, shareable, and harmless to expose. Every transaction coming into your wallet flows through this public key.
Your Private Key—Your Ultimate Secret This is the master password to your funds. It’s the only proof you need to authorize outgoing transactions and move your assets. Losing this key means losing access to your crypto permanently. Storing it securely and backing it up properly is non-negotiable for long-term asset safety.
When you send cryptocurrency, you use your private key to cryptographically sign the transaction. This signature proves the funds are yours and authorizes their transfer. The blockchain records this transaction permanently, creating an immutable ledger of all activity.
How Wallets Function in Practice
Let’s walk through how crypto wallets actually work when you use them:
Sending Assets: You initiate a transfer from your wallet, signing it with your private key to prove ownership. The transaction broadcasts to the network, gets validated by nodes, and then is permanently recorded on the blockchain. Once confirmed, the recipient has full control of those funds.
Receiving Assets: You share your public wallet address with someone sending you crypto. They input this address as the destination, and the blockchain automatically routes the funds to your wallet. You can then verify the incoming transaction using your wallet’s interface.
Storing Crypto: Interestingly, your crypto isn’t actually “in” your wallet in the traditional sense. The blockchain holds all cryptocurrency records; your wallet simply controls access to it. The wallet’s job is to securely store your private key so you can manage what’s recorded on the blockchain in your name.
Beyond just cryptocurrency, wallets also serve as your gateway to decentralized finance and NFTs. They let you interact with decentralized applications directly from your device.
The Main Categories of Crypto Wallets
Different wallet types balance security, accessibility, and control differently. Here’s what distinguishes each category:
Hardware Wallets: Maximum Security Through Isolation
These physical devices store your private keys completely offline, eliminating online attack vectors. You plug them in only when you need to authorize transactions. Examples include Ledger, Trezor, and KeepKey. The trade-off: they’re less convenient for frequent trading but unbeatable for protecting large holdings. Even if your computer gets hacked, your hardware wallet remains secure. Many include additional protections like PIN codes and recovery seed phrases.
Software Wallets: Balance of Convenience and Control
Desktop Versions: Applications installed directly on your computer, like Exodus, Electrum, and Atomic Wallet. You control your own private keys and can access your funds anytime, but they’re only as secure as your computer’s protection.
Mobile Applications: Smartphone wallets like Trust Wallet and Mycelium offer maximum portability. You can send and receive funds anywhere, but mobile devices face unique security risks since you carry them everywhere.
Web-Based Options: Browser-based wallets like MetaMask and MyEtherWallet work instantly without installation. They’re convenient for frequent users and dApp access, but they’re online by default, creating exposure to web-based threats.
Paper Wallets: The Offline Alternative
These involve printing your keys on physical paper and storing it securely. It’s cold storage at its most basic, but it requires careful handling to prevent loss, damage, or accidental exposure.
Brain Wallets: Memory-Dependent Storage
These use a memorized passphrase to generate your keys. The advantage is maximum portability—you only need to remember something. The disadvantage is vulnerability to weak passphrases and potential memory loss.
Custodial Wallets: Convenience Through Third Parties
Some platforms manage your keys for you. You trade control for convenience—no need to worry about backing up or securing keys yourself. The downside: you’re trusting a company to safeguard your assets, and they could face hacks, regulatory issues, or shutdowns.
Selecting the Right Wallet for Your Needs
Your choice should depend on honestly assessing your usage patterns and priorities. There’s no universally perfect wallet—only the right one for you.
Security as Your Foundation If you’re holding crypto long-term without planning to trade frequently, prioritize security above all. Look for wallets offering encryption, key ownership, and multi-factor authentication. Hardware wallets excel here because offline storage eliminates entire categories of digital attacks. For serious coin collectors, this is the standard choice.
Accessibility Matters for Daily Users If you trade frequently or make regular payments, convenience becomes critical. Mobile and web wallets let you transact instantly. For newcomers especially, an easy-to-navigate interface reduces mistakes. Trading platforms often provide wallet functionality with simplified user experiences—though this convenience comes at the cost of not controlling your own keys.
Cost Considerations Some wallets are free; others charge per transaction. Hardware wallets cost money upfront but excel at protecting significant holdings over years. Software wallets are usually free but may include transaction fees. Calculate total cost of ownership based on how frequently you plan to transact.
Your Specific Use Case Shapes the Decision An active trader might prefer a web wallet integrated with trading tools. A long-term holder focused on security would choose hardware storage. Someone interested in NFTs and decentralized finance needs a wallet compatible with Ethereum and blockchain applications. Someone holding diverse altcoins needs broad asset support.
Verify Cryptocurrency Support Most popular wallets support Bitcoin and Ethereum, but not all support every altcoin. Before committing, confirm your wallet of choice handles every asset you plan to hold.
Real-World Examples of Popular Wallets
For Maximum Security: Trezor
This hardware wallet has earned trust through consistent security practices. As a physical device kept offline, it shields your keys from internet threats. Even if your computer is compromised, your Trezor remains secure. It includes PIN protection and generates a 24-word recovery code—if the device is lost or stolen, you can rebuild it elsewhere.
Trezor supports the major cryptocurrencies like Bitcoin and Ethereum plus numerous altcoins, making it practical for diverse portfolios. Its interface handles basic functions like sending, receiving, and balance checking without unnecessary complexity.
For Everyday Use: Exodus
This software wallet delivers an attractive interface combined with genuine functionality. Install it on your computer or phone, and you get custody of your own keys plus convenient access. It handles Bitcoin, Ethereum, Litecoin, and hundreds of altcoins, so it scales with your portfolio growth.
A built-in exchange feature lets you swap coins directly without leaving the app, adding real utility beyond simple storage. It appeals to both experienced traders seeking portfolio management and newcomers wanting straightforward functionality.
For Mobile Ethereum Users: Trust Wallet
If you work with Ethereum tokens and decentralized applications, Trust Wallet specializes in this space. It supports ERC20, ERC721, and ERC1155 standards—essentially all major Ethereum token types. It works as both a mobile app and browser extension, letting you interact with DeFi platforms directly from your phone.
This wallet removes barriers to participating in decentralized finance. No extra software or awkward transfers needed—you connect straight from your mobile wallet to dApps on the blockchain.
